Walmart is offering a 3-piece rattan patio furniture set originally priced at $500 for a flash deal discount of 49% off. The promotion, described as having “glamorous resort vibes,” highlights the retailer’s aggressive pricing strategy as the outdoor living season approaches.

Walmart recently launched a flash deal on a 3-piece rattan patio furniture set, slashing the price by nearly half. The set, which originally retails for $500, is now available at a 49% discount during the limited-time promotion. The furniture features an aesthetically pleasing design that the company says evokes “glamorous resort vibes,” catering to consumers seeking affordable luxury for outdoor spaces.
The flash deal is part of Walmart’s broader seasonal push to capture early summer spending. With warmer weather arriving across much of the US, demand for patio and garden furniture typically rises. By offering deep discounts on popular styles, Walmart aims to compete with both big-box retailers and online home goods specialists. The promotion is available while supplies last, adding a sense of urgency for shoppers.
Walmart has been actively using flash deals and limited-time offers to drive traffic both in stores and online. This strategy helps the retailer clear seasonal inventory and attract price-sensitive consumers. The rattan set, a common choice for outdoor seating, may appeal to budget-conscious buyers looking to furnish decks, balconies, or patios without spending thousands.

Key Highlights
- Flash deal pricing: The 3-piece rattan set is offered at 49% off its original $500 price, a significant markdown that may draw bargain seekers.
- Design appeal: The set is marketed with “glamorous resort vibes,” suggesting a focus on aesthetics alongside functionality — a trend in outdoor furniture where style increasingly drives purchase decisions.
- Seasonal timing: The promotion aligns with late spring, a peak period for outdoor furniture sales as consumers prepare for summer entertaining.
- Retail strategy: Walmart’s use of flash deals could help the company gain market share in the home and garden category, which has seen heightened competition from e-commerce platforms and warehouse clubs.
- Consumer implications: The discount reflects broader retail trends of aggressive price cuts to stimulate demand amid cautious consumer spending on big-ticket items.

Expert Insights
The flash deal on patio furniture comes as retailers navigate a complex consumer environment. While inflation has eased, many households remain focused on value-seeking behavior. Walmart’s decision to offer a 49% discount on a moderately priced set may indicate the company’s assessment that price promotions are necessary to convert browsing into purchases for discretionary goods like outdoor furniture.
From a sector perspective, such flash deals can put pressure on competitors to match discounts, potentially squeezing margins across the home improvement retail space. However, for Walmart, the promotion could drive foot traffic and online engagement, supporting overall sales volume even if the furniture category itself carries lower margins.
The focus on “resort vibes” also underscores a shift in consumer preferences toward experiential aesthetics in home goods. Retailers that successfully blend style with affordability may be better positioned to capture demand during the spring-summer transition. Still, the limited-time nature of flash deals means the impact on long-term category performance will depend on how quickly inventory turns and whether follow-up promotions sustain momentum.
As the outdoor living season unfolds, Walmart’s pricing moves will be watched as a potential bellwether for broader retail health. Analysts suggest that continued discounting in home categories could signal ongoing consumer reluctance to spend at full price, while robust sell-through of flash deal items may point to resilient demand among bargain-oriented shoppers.
